Stat Lauren Elaina Friedman sold $256K of PLTR

Stat Lauren Elaina Friedman sold 1,598 shares of Palantir Technologies Inc. (PLTR) at $160.00 ($0.26M total) on 2026-06-01 under a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

Background

This is an SEC Form 4 insider transaction (director) for Palantir, reporting an open-market sale execut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 plan.
